Delicious Dense Bean Salad

This flavorful bean salad is packed with a variety of beans, vegetables, and a tangy vinaigrette, making it a healthy and satisfying meal.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Course Salad
Cuisine American
Servings 6 servings
Calories 210 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 can Canned black beans drained and rinsed
  • 1 can Canned kidney beans drained and rinsed
  • 1 can Chickpeas drained and rinsed
  • 1 large Red bell pepper diced
  • 1 medium Cucumber diced
  • 1 cup Cherry tomatoes halved
  • 1/4 cup Red onion finely chopped
  • 2 tbsp Olive oil
  • 2 tbsp Lemon juice
  • 1 tbsp Ap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tbsp Honey
  • 1 tsp Garlic powder
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Black pepper

Instructions
 

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the black beans, kidney beans, chickpeas, diced red bell pepper, cucumber, halved cherry tomatoes, and finely chopped red onion.
  • In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, honey,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per to make the dressing.
  • Pour the dressing over the bean mixture and toss gently to combine. Make sure all ingredients are coated with the dressing.
  • Serve immediately or refrigerate for an hour to allow the flavors to meld. Enjoy!

Notes

This salad can be customized by adding your favorite herbs or spices. It’s also great with some fresh cilantro or parsley for extra freshness.

How to Make the Recipe

To start, gather the ingredients. In a large mixing bowl, combine the black beans, kidney beans, and chickpeas that have been drained and rinsed. These beans provide a hearty base for the salad, giving it a satisfying density and plenty of protein. Add the diced red bell pepper, cucumber, halved cherry tomatoes, and finely chopped red onion to the bowl for added crunch, flavor, and freshness.

Next, prepare the dressing.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, honey,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. The combination of olive oil and vinegar adds a tangy richness, while the honey balances it with a touch of sweetness. Garlic powder adds a savory depth to the dressing.

Once the dressing is prepared, pour it over the bean mixture and toss gently to ensure everything is evenly coated. The salad can be served immediately, but it’s often even better after being refrigerated for an hour, allowing the flavors to meld and intensify.

This bean salad is not only a delicious and filling dish but also versatile. You can customize it by adding fresh herbs like cilantro or parsley for extra flavor. It’s perfect for meal prepping, serving as a main dish, or accompanying grilled meats.
